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79004 5869057 04 97605 755387
2379541 10528 9924
2379541 10528 9924
028918161 4497060539 87615028
All about undefined
Interested in learning more?
2379541 10528 9924
028918161 4497060539 87615028
See more
290724989 07372124
13767760 367302 43 058
See more
1289619 19936746561 47534
239 9749 922932 67272 45120722
See more